logo

Output 81eb66b312aeb91d71f19d5483f0547fc3ff6736249710eba0f6b353ccf8229a:0

value
20522505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656329f20fc9a018f66fc2245a5c58401847f18e OP_EQUAL
address
3Aw6xwgsCip5Egsdjf4AMEvVodC59KNDEk
transaction
81eb66b312aeb91d71f19d5483f0547fc3ff6736249710eba0f6b353ccf8229a